The Winterhawks have been flying with 8 straight wins and a 7 point lead at the top of their conference. But they’ve now been hit by the injury bug. Kyle Chyzowski and Luke Schelter this weekend joined Diego Buttazzoni with week-to-week injuries. That put the Winterhawks down to 10 healthy forwards. To pick up the slack they’ve called up 16-year-olds Cole Cairns and Hudson Darby. They’ll get thrown into it with 3 road games in 5 days, in Everett, Seattle, and Vancouver.
The good news is that goalie Dante Giannuzzi has been on a good run, culminating in him being named WHL Goaltender of the Week. They’re also looking to continue their streak of outshooting the opposition; they’ve done it in all 19 games so far.

The Silvertips don’t have much sympathy for the Winterhawks’ injury troubles as theirs are a lot worse. They’ve missed their best offensive player, Jackson Berezowski, two top-4 defensemen, one of their Euro forwards, and four depth players. Luckily, a lot of the are listed as day-to-day, so they’ll be back soon if not in this game.
After losing to Portland on Friday, they played a good game against Seattle, leading 1-0 after 2 periods, but ended up losing in overtime. They haven’t had an easy time holding leads. They’ve led 14 times and been tied twice after 2 periods, but only have 12 wins.
